LeBron James Doubtful for Lakers' Showdown Against Bucks Amidst Ankle Soreness


In a critical matchup against the Milwaukee Bucks, the Los Angeles Lakers may be without superstar LeBron James due to lingering soreness in his left ankle. This potential setback comes at a crucial time for the Lakers as they embark on a challenging six-game road trip while fighting for playoff positioning in the competitive Western Conference. Despite James' absence, the Lakers managed to secure a win over the Bucks earlier this season, showcasing their depth and resilience as they navigate through a pivotal stretch of games.

With only 11 games remaining in the regular season, every matchup is of utmost importance for the Lakers as they aim to climb the standings and secure a playoff spot without having to go through the play-in tournament. The absence of James could provide an opportunity for other players like Spencer Dinwiddie to step up and make an impact in his absence.
